|
Employee Benefit Plans - Accumulated Benefit Obligation For Pension Benefit Plans (Detail) - Pension Benefits - USD ($)
$ in Millions
|12 Months Ended
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|United States
|Defined Contribution And Defined Benefit Plans
|Accumulated benefit obligation
|$ 441
|$ 430
|Defined Benefit Plan, Benefit Obligation
|443
|434
|$ 400
|Service costs
|10
|10
|13
|Interest cost
|22
|22
|13
|Non-United States Plans
|Defined Contribution And Defined Benefit Plans
|Accumulated benefit obligation
|500
|480
|Defined Benefit Plan, Benefit Obligation
|553
|525
|461
|Service costs
|35
|35
|29
|Interest cost
|$ 17
|$ 17
|$ 8
|X
- Definition
+ References
Defined Contribution and Defined Benefit Plans [Line Items]
+ Details
No definition available.
|X
- Definition
+ References
Amount of actuarial present value of benefits attributed to employee service rendered, excluding assumptions about future compensation level.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of actuarial present value of benefits attributed to service rendered by employee for defined benefit pl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cost recognized for passage of time related to defined benefit pl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of cost for actuarial present value of benefits attributed to service rendered by employee for defined benefit pl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Details
|X
- Details
|X
- Details